Occasional episodes of aggressive driving–such as speeding and changing lanes abruptly–might occur in response to specific situations, like when the driver is late for an important appointment, but is not the driver’s normal behavior. For others, episodes of aggressive driving are frequent, and for a small proportion of motorists it is their usual driving behavior. Most motorists rarely drive aggressively, and some never do. This can lead to some people feeling less constrained in their behavior when they cannot be seen by others and/or when it is unlikely that they will ever again see those who witness their behavior.

Shielded from the outside environment, a driver can develop a sense of detachment, as if an observer of their surroundings, rather than a participant. Some people drive aggressively because they have too much to do and are “running late” for work, school, their next meeting, lesson, soccer game, or other appointment.Ī motor vehicle insulates the driver from the world.

Drivers may respond by using aggressive driving behaviors, including speeding, changing lanes frequently, or becoming angry at anyone who they believe impedes their progress. Traffic congestion is one of the most frequently mentioned contributing factors to aggressive driving, such as speeding.
